Transaction 39f8539389d2b9eb04eca884515174ab1c8220782565cdc5418f6a98ec3351d8
1 Input
1 Output
-
39f8539389d2b9eb04eca884515174ab1c8220782565cdc5418f6a98ec3351d8:0
- value
- 802079
- script pubkey
- OP_0 OP_PUSHBYTES_20 25a5c14d0c0563128eaf5c7c0fb29f446ac86069
- address
- bc1qykjuzngvq4339r40t37qlv5lg34vscrfaazyjm